I didn't feel my heart at all for 6 weeks post ablation but now get some mild episodes of AF. It sounds as though you are doing very well BUT you must realize that it's still early days. It will take at least 3 months for the heart to heal so you must take it easy and rest, rest, rest.
Yes, you are being impatient. Remember that your heart has taken a pounding. It had suffered before the ablation and was then burned and poked by a laser.

Yes, it sounds like you are being a little impatient. It's still very early days after your ablation and can take 3 - 6 months to fully recover.
I've had three and felt differently after each one. After the first two I was extremely tired for several months and after the second - well I felt as though nothing had been done so felt fine immediately.
As you are feeling very tired I would say your body is telling you to slow down and let your heart heal. Please listen to it or you may undo all the good work that has been done by the procedure.
